Festive Season Boosts Italian Sparkling Wine Sales

Dec 20, 2017 937

Italian sparkling wines are set to dominate Christmas and New Year parties, with an 11% growth in foreign sales expected this year, according to Italian farmers' association Coldiretti. Based on Istat data for the first eight months of the year, Coldiretti anticipates that exports will surpass €1.3 billion in 2017, with an estimated production of more than 600 million bottles.

Coldiretti says that the UK was the world's leading market for Italian sparkling wine in 2017, with a 13% growth in exported bottles. This was ahead of the US, which saw growth of 16%, followed by Germany with a 14% increase. The best-selling Italian sparkling wines in these markets are Prosecco, Asti and Franciacorta.
